How do you pull the plastic inserts out of the Sigelei #8 caps? Are the plastic inserts molded or threaded inside the Sigelei bottom cap? Also, since the inside of the cap is threaded, would I get better results by yanking out that plastic insert, discarding of the spring and screw to fit the spring, and just putting in a flat top brass screw? Also, how do you disassemble the fire button on the #8?
The inserts are threaded into the caps; unscrew, dont pull. For the firing button, hold the inside part of the pin and unscrew the button. You many need to heat it up a little to break the bond of the thread locker. A BiC will do the trick.
Best thing I did to my 8's was scrap the spring and expose the brass.
Here are my spring delete mods:
Original "no modification required" mod
I ran that way for a good long time without any problems. Then I finally got around to firing up the lathe to do this...
I took two 8-32 brass nuts and turned them down to .238" and then knurled the O.D (.242" final diameter). Cut down a 8-32 brass screw equal to the length of the two nuts, assembled the nuts on the screw, and pressed the assembly into the spring cup.
